报价请求(RFQ)页面 — 原生报价工作流
Vertex 提供完全原生的报价请求(RFQ)页面。 无报价管理应用、无第三方表单生成器、无 Zapier 集成、无月度订阅。该页面使用 Shopify 内置的 {% form 'contact' %} 模式捕获自定义定价请求,在提交时将其发送给商家,向买家发送自动回复,并呈现一个简洁的编辑性 2 列布局,与店铺前端的其余部分保持一致。
如果您的买家定期请求自定义价格、批量折扣、项目报价或合同定价 — RFQ 页面是 Vertex 捕获这些请求的方式,无需您安装 30 美元/月的报价应用。
开箱即用的内容
| 文件 | 用途 |
|---|---|
templates/page.rfq.json | 应用于 /pages/rfq 页面的页面模板 |
sections/main-rfq.liquid | 渲染整个 RFQ 页面(表单 + 联系卡片)的单一分区 |
locales/*.json 字符串 | 所有 5 种支持的语言(英语、法语、意大利语、德语、西班牙 语)中的 RFQ 字段标签 + 帮助文本 |
sections/main-rfq.liquid schema | 标题、介绍文本、联系卡片内容、NET-30 切换、响应 SLA 文本的设置 |
安装 Vertex 时,page.rfq.json 模板会立即在页面模板下拉框中可用。您只需创建一个页面,分配模板,表单就会渲染。
RFQ 页面的样子
该页面是一个2 列编辑性布局:
左列 — RFQ 表单
| 字段 | 类型 | 必填 | 用途 |
|---|---|---|---|
| Your name | 文本 | 是 | 名 + 姓 |
| Company name | 文本 | 是 | 买家的公司(驱动商家跟进路由) |
| 电子邮件 | 是 | 用于自动回复 + 商家响应 | |
| Phone | 电话 | 可选 | 对紧急报价有用 |
| Job title / role | 文本 | 可选 | "Procurement Manager"、"Facilities Lead" 等 |
| Country / region | 选择 | 可选 | 在商家方驱动 ship-from / 税务路由 |
| Product list (SKUs + qty) | 多行文本区域 | 是 | 每行一个 SKU。格式:SKU, quantity — 例如,BX-450, 100 然后换行 BX-451, 50 |
| Target ship date | 日期选择器 | 可选 | 对项目报价 / 预定交付有用 |
| Project notes / additional details | 文本区域 | 可选 | 用于上下文、特殊要求、所需证书的自由文本 |
| NET-30 opt-in checkbox | 布尔值 | 可选(可切换) | 如果您的店铺提供 NET-30,买家可以内联请求 |
| GDPR / privacy consent | 布尔值 | 在欧盟市场为是 | 启用 Shopify 的 Customer Privacy 时自动渲染 |
表单是服务器渲染的 HTML(无 JavaScript 表单框架)。即使没有 JS 的浏览器也可以成功提交。提交按钮具有完整的键盘焦点 + AT 友好的标签。

提交如何到达商家
表单使用 Shopify 的原生 {% form 'contact' %} 模式。这意味着:
1. 提交电子邮件发送给商家
当买家提交时,Shopify 会向 Settings ▸ General ▸ Sender email 中设置的联系电子邮件发送电子邮件。该电子邮件包含所有表单字段,格式整洁。
您可以通过以下方式将收件 人更改为专用地址(例如,[email protected]):
- 将 Settings ▸ General ▸ Sender email 更新为
[email protected],或 - 设置从
[email protected]到[email protected]的电子邮件转发规则,或 -(高级)连接一个 Shopify Flow 触发器,拦截联系表单 webhook 并路由到别处
2. 自动回复给买家
Shopify 会自动向买家的电子邮件发送自动回复,确认已收到提交。您可以在 Settings ▸ Notifications ▸ Contact form notification 中自定义此自动回复文本。
典型的自定义自动回复:
Hi
{first_name},Thanks for reaching out to Acme Industrial Supply. We've received your quote request and will respond within 1 business day.
For urgent requests, call 1-800-555-1212 (Mon–Fri 8am–6pm EST).
— The Acme Sales Team
3. 可选:客户记录创建
如果您希望每个 RFQ 提交也在 Shopify 中创建客户记录(对 Klaviyo / Mailchimp 中的跟进序列很有用),请设置一个 Shopify Flow 触发器:
- 触发器:Contact form submitted
- 条件:Form contains "RFQ"
- 操作:Create or update customer,带电子邮件 + 姓名 + 标签
rfq-lead
这将 RFQ 表单转换为一个潜在客户捕获界 面,与您选择的 CRM / 电子邮件工具集成。
配置页面
让 RFQ 上线需要三步。
第 1 步 — 检查 / 创建 RFQ 页面
- 打开 Online Store ▸ Pages
- 查找名为 "Request a Quote" 的页面(Vertex 的演示内容会在安装时创建此页面)
- 如果缺失,请点击 Add page:
- 标题: "Request a Quote"
- 句柄:
rfq(以便 URL 为/pages/rfq) - 内容: 留空(模板渲染所有内容)
- 模板: 从右侧模板下拉框中选择
page.rfq - 可见性: 可见
- 保存
访问 https://your-store.myshopify.com/pages/rfq 以确认页面渲染。

第 2 步 — 自定义分区设置
- 打开 Online Store ▸ Themes ▸ Customize
- 在顶部模板下拉框中,选择 Pages ▸ Request a Quote
- 点击左侧边栏中的 Main RFQ 分区
- 编辑分区设置:
| 设置 | 默认 | 自定义为 |
|---|---|---|
| 标题 | "Request a Quote" | 您喜欢的标题(例如,"Get a quote in 48 hours") |
| 介绍文本 | "Tell us what you need..." | 您的价值主张 |
| 联系卡片标题 | "Talk to our team" | "Our sales team is standing by" |
| 销售电子邮件 | (占位符) | 您的真实销售电子邮件 |
| 销售电话 | (占位符) | 您的真实销售电话 |
| 办公时间 | (占位符) | 您的真实时间 |
| 提示代码 | "RFQ-V1" | 禁用,或设置您自己的代码 |
| 显示 NET-30 选择 | 开启 | 如果您不提供 NET-30,则关闭 |
| 表单字段标签 | (默认值) | 内联覆盖任何字段标签 |
| 必填字段 | (姓名、公司、电子邮件、产品) | 如果您希望电话必填,请添加电话 |
| 提交按钮文本 | "Send request" | "Get my quote" |
| 配色方案 | Background 1 | 您的任何配色方案 |
- 保存
自定义器实时预览更改。表单完全内联可编辑 — 包括通过分区块管理添加新字段。
第 3 步 — 从 header 链接 RFQ 页面
当从 header 辅助菜单链接时,RFQ 页面最可发现。
- 打开 Online Store ▸ Navigation
- 打开 Secondary menu(或创建一个,如果不存在 — Vertex 会自动检测名为
secondary-menu的菜单) - 添加菜单项:
- 名称: "Request a Quote"(或 "Get a Quote")
- 链接: Pages ▸ Request a Quote
- 保存菜单
链接现在将渲染在 header 顶部的右对齐辅助导航中(桌面端)和移动抽屉的辅助部分中。
许多商家还在首页的 B2B 功能促销条和页脚前区域的 CTA 横幅中添加 RFQ CTA。两个分区都接受免费 CTA URL — 将它们指向 /pages/rfq。
商家工作流
买家开始提交 RFQ 后,以下是处理它们的方法。